Output 89192e5128500195a05753dbb84b62f1f3cea0abcf8a3fbfa05bc7d1ac17d85a:0

value
536081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45c0234bf662a78390a75df8e4b174b5a12ce646 OP_EQUAL
address
383pikgC6UpjvyFpuZNFmWyX7BUgrjTwuV
transaction
89192e5128500195a05753dbb84b62f1f3cea0abcf8a3fbfa05bc7d1ac17d85a
spent
true